About Your New Role :

As a vital member of our Open Minds Team, you'll be assisting our clients with complex needs on-site in Logan. Each day will be unique, but shifts may include assistance with mental health challenges, personal care, household duties, and medication management. Above all, you will provide companionship and build meaningful, caring relationships.

About You :

  • Excels in complex support environments, including Supported Independent Living, Clinical Settings, and Community Access
  • Experience working with complex support needs, implementing Positive Behavioural Support Plans, and handling mental health challenges
  • Experience in providing Spinal and Acquired Brain Injury supports
  • Can prioritise workloads and respond to emergent situations with ease
  • Can work across various shifts, including mornings, afternoons and nights throughout the week
